WebFoster parents are individuals or couples with a genuine interest in caring for children or youth. They come from all walks of life, with a wide variety of culture, ethnicity, faith, education, experience and background. Foster parents come with many differing levels of experience with children; some having raised their own children, some who ... Web30 apr. 2024 · How much do foster parents get paid in Florida per month? Foster parents are paid $429 a month for children up to age 5, $440 a month for children 6 to 12 and $515 a month for children 13 and older, according to the Department of Children and Families. Foster parents with a license to care for children with therapeutic needs are paid more.
